BREAKER
RATINGS
AKR
breakers
a.reavailable
inthree
frame
sizes
--
800,
1600
and
2000
amperes.
These
values
re_
present
the
maximum
continuous
current
capability
of
the
respective
frames.
However,
each
breaker
carries
a
specificrating
whichis
determined
by
the
current.sensor
€rmpere
rating(or
tap
setting)
of
tt"
trip
device
with
which
it
is
equipped.
EXAMPLE:
An
AKR-5A-3O
breaker
with
SST
sensor
tap
set
on
1004
is
rated
100A.
Short
cir
cuit
ratings
vary
with
the
applied
system
voltage..
OTZ
!
V
systems
they
are
atso
Oependent
upon
whether
the
overcurrent
trip
device
contains
an
instantaneous
trip
element.
See
lante
Z.
